TIL that after visiting the Three Mile Island nuclear plant’s accident in 1979, Jimmy Carter—trained in nuclear power from the US Navy—told his cabinet that the incident was minor. The president did not say so in public, however, to avoid offending fellow Democrats who opposed nuclear power.

VBYaG TIL that Black Genesis, the second book in L. Ron Hubbard's series Mission Earth, was one of five nominees for the 1987 Hugo Award for Best Novel. It came in 6th place, behind all four other nominees as well as "No Award."

69BdJ TIL that the upside down Cross was originally associated with St Peter who, according to catholic tradition, was crucified upside down upon request. He felt unworthy to die in the same way as his savior.
